今天在XenServer中安装虚拟机时出现如下错误:
原因:没有开启XenServer服务器主机的虚拟化支持功能
解决办法:在XenServer主机的BIOS里开启CPU的虚拟化支持功能
本文出自 “憂零的博客” 博客,请务必保留此出处http://sunyu.blog.51cto.com/744725/724298
如果你的系统现在是Linux 你如何知道你的cpu是否支持虚拟化呢?
cpu主流分两种Intel 和AMD
首先说intel
运行命令grep vmx /proc/cpuinfo
如果回车后能找到vmx相关的内容那就是支持的 如果没任何返回内容那就是不支持的
AMD
grep svm /proc/cpuinfo
不知道芯片的生产厂商则输入:egrep '(vmx|svm)' /proc/cpuinfo
如果flags: 里有vmx 或者svm就说明支持VT;如果没有任何的输出,说明你的cpu不支持
这个如果你想装KVM虚拟机的话 不支持虚拟化是无法安装的。但现在的xenserver 如果不支持的话那你也只能创建Linux的VM但无法创建windows的vm主机
就会报上面的错误咯!
用xenserver 和xencenter 创建VM时提示
xenserver-jcaiwiokNot enough server memory is available to per
提示已经没有足够的内存使用了。所以你需要增加内存条